Silver Wedding Celebration
In celebration of their silver wedding anniversary Mr. and Mrs. T. Hicks, Carthew Street, Feilding, recently entertained friends at a delightful evening in the Parish Hall to mark the culmination of 25 years of their marriage. Dancing was enjoyed to the music of an orchestra, the hall presenting a cheery atmosphere with its lounge and ' 1 bowls of bright autumn flowers. At the supper interval Mr. and Mrs. p- Hicks were presented with a handsome or chiming clock with best wishes and ie congratulations from friends. Mrs. Hicks appeared in a charming gown of cyclamen satin, while Mrs. Worsfold, her bridesmaid, wore green floral silk. The toast list included, honours to the a bride and bridegroom, the bridesmaid, ar the children (Colin and Betty), Mrs. to Hicks’ parents (Mr; and Mrs. Tobeck) and Mrs. Duckworth, 6f Napier. Flowers in the supper room had been ar- '• ranged by Mrs. Lowe, Kiwitea, while the much admired wedding cake was the work of the guest of honour, Mrs. Geo. Wilkinson being responsible for its decoration. The event was a happy one, Mr. and Mrs. Hicks receiving _ many congratulations on this attainment in their lives.
